Transaction e2a99d22d1910c0b99da656a07c9e400414badfeb95299bad046dd5f33f7b9ab
1 Input
1 Output
-
e2a99d22d1910c0b99da656a07c9e400414badfeb95299bad046dd5f33f7b9ab:0
- value
- 67304988
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db53f102a7e9d3904dabf0c84c2fb5fcec72d70b OP_EQUAL
- address
- 3MgiTuejdygqW8aqCsUUAJ2DGQkCoMBJC6